Sticking with it, staying calm, coming up with new ideas, trying again.
Use the skill:
Use transitions for frustrating tasks. For example, “You have just 2 more homework questions, then we can play.”
Purpose: Transitions let your child prepare to stop doing something they like. This makes it easier to stay calm when they have to stop. Transitions also tell children that a frustrating task will end soon. This helps them stick with it.
